      <description>&lt;D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;FROM THE ARTICLE - SEE ARTICLE FOR MORE!!!&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;5 Actions to Take for 2025 During Medicare Open Enrollment.&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;Tips for choosing a Medicare Advantage or Part D prescription plan in a year of historic change.&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;By Kimberly Lankford, AARP. Published October 04, 2024.&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;Be prepared for one of the biggest changes to the Medicare prescription drug program ever: In 2025, out-of-pocket costs for covered drugs will be limited to $2,000 annually.&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;The new cap applies to stand-alone Part D and Medicare Advantage (MA) plans with drug coverage. But the change is rippling down to other costs and coverage.&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;DIV&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://www.aarp.org/health/medicare-insurance/info-2024/open-enrollment-action-plan.html" target="_blank"&gt;https://www.aarp.org/health/medicare-insurance/info-2024/open-enrollment-action-plan.html&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
